Abstract

The invention relates to a device (10; 10a) for metering fine-grained filling material, in particular pharmaceuticals, into packaging containers (1), with a reservoir (11; 11a) for the filling material and a metering unit (15; 15a) arranged at the plane below the reservoir (11; 11a), and the metering unit comprises at least one metering chamber (22) for storing a nominal filling quantity of the filling material, wherein the metering unit (15; 15a) is arranged between at least two different positions in adjustable manner: a transferring position in which the filling material is lead from the reservoir (11; 11a) into the metering chamber (22), and a dispensing position in which the filling material is dispensed from the metering chamber (22) into the packaging containers (1), and comprising a conveying device (100) used for the to be filled packaging container (1) that the packaging container (1) aligns the dispensing position of the metering unit (15; 15a) below the metering unit (15; 15a).

[0001] The invention relates to a device for dosing fine-grain fillings into packaging containers according to the preamble of claim 1 . Background technique

[0002] Such a device is known from DE 10 2011 085 283 A1 of the applicant. It comprises a dosing unit which is rotatably mounted in a horizontally arranged shaft and has a plurality of dosing chambers for each receiving a nominal filling quantity of medicament. In a first position for transferring medicament from the storage container, a corresponding dosing chamber is arranged below the storage container. The filling (medicine) either falls by gravity alone or is assisted by negative pressure from the storage container into the dosing chamber. The dosing unit is then rotated by 180Β° on its axis to dispense the filling product into the packaging container. This can possibly be achieved with the aid of compressed air.
